Are people in Greenville older or younger than people in Martinsville?
- The Median Age in Greenville is 1.3 years older than in Martinsville.

Are housing costs cheaper in Greenville or Martinsville?
- Greenville housing costs are 37.3% more expensive than Martinsville hous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Greenville or Martinsville?
- The average commute for residents of Greenville is 6.8 minutes longer than it is for residents of Martinsville.

Things to do in Greenville?
Living in Greenville, GA is a unique experience. This small town offers a relaxed atmosphere with plenty of activities to enjoy. The town’s historic downtown district is full of antique stores and restaurants, making it a great place to take a stroll and explore the different shops. Greenville also has two local parks where you can have picnics, play sports, or just relax. The city is surrounded by nature so there are plenty of opportunities to take in the beauty of the outdoors. Despite its small size, there really is something for everyone in this charming Southern community.
